What does it mean when your blood pressure is 130 over 55?

Normal: Less than 120 mm Hg for systolic and 80 mm Hg for diastolic. Elevated: Between 120-129 for systolic, and less than 80 for diastolic. Stage 1 hypertension: Between 130-139 for systolic or between 80-89 for diastolic. Stage 2 hypertension: At least 140 for systolic or at least 90 mm Hg for diastolic.

What is stroke Zone blood pressure?

Blood pressure readings above 180/120 mmHg are considered stroke-level, dangerously high, and require immediate medical attention.

What should I do if my diastolic is low?

There are some things you can do to help prevent and manage low diastolic pressure:

  1. Try to keep your salt intake to between 1.5 and 4 grams per day.
  2. Eat a heart-healthy diet.
  3. Drink enough fluids and avoid alcohol, which can increase your risk of dehydration.
  4. Stay physically active and start an exercise program.
